Abstract: REHAP’s 15 partners aim at revalorizing agricultural (wheat straw) and forestry (bark) waste
through its recovery, and primary (sugars, lignin, tannins) and secondary (sugar acids, carboxylic
acids, aromatics and resins) processing to turn them into novel materials, and considering Green
Building as business case. The project will provide reductions in utilization of fossil resources of
80-100%, and energy utilization and CO2 emissions above 30%.
